Output 64e9e9703024587d8576ff4bd6688579c14fa3d4e96c4446da43ccb9779cf8da:29

value
46598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fae68735be351ac5dff7c8709445e1c875ec528 OP_EQUAL
address
3DL8fzDEh5h8rwR4ZEaF3eUnwjCMQK4JyC
transaction
64e9e9703024587d8576ff4bd6688579c14fa3d4e96c4446da43ccb9779cf8da